首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include<iostream> using namespace std; class Base{ protected: Base(){cout<<’Base’;} Base(char
有如下程序: #include<iostream> using namespace std; class Base{ protected: Base(){cout<<’Base’;} Base(char
admin
2013-02-27
26
问题
有如下程序: #include<iostream> using namespace std; class Base{ protected: Base(){cout<<’Base’;} Base(char c){cout<<c;} }; class Derived:public Base{ public: Derived(char c){cout<<c;} }; int main(){ Derived d(’Derived’); return 0; } 执行这个程序屏幕上将显示输出( )。
选项
A、Derived
B、DerivedBase
C、BaseDerived
D、DerivedDerived
答案
C
解析
派生类Derived由基类Base公有派生,在派生类构造函数声明时系统会自动调用基类的缺省构造函数。调用Derived d(’Derived’);后,执行类Derived构造函数的Derived(char c),系统自动调用基类的缺省构造函数Base(),输出字母Base;再执行派生类的构造函数Derived(char c),输出字母Derived。
转载请注明原文地址:https://jikaoti.com/ti/EeE0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
若有定义“inta,b,c;”以下程序段的输出结果是()。 a=11;b=3;c=0; printf("%d\n",c=(a/b,a%b));
若变量已正确定义为int型,要通过语句“scanf("%d,%d,%d",&a,&b,&c);”将a赋值为1、将b赋值为2、将c赋值为3,以下输入形式中错误的是(注:□代表一个空格符)()。
有以下程序 #include<stdio.h> main() {chara[5][10]={"China","beijing","very","welcome","you"}; char*p[5];inti; for(i=3
有以下程序 #include<stdio.h> main() {inta[3][3]3={0,1,2,3,4,5,6,7,8},(*p)[3],i; p=a; for(i=0;i<3;i++) {printf("%d",(*
有以下程序(注:字符a的ASCII码值为97): #include<stdio.h> main() {char*s={"abe"}; do {printf("%d",*s%10); ++s: }whil
设有如下类型说明语句 typedefstruct {intnum; struct{inty,m,d;}date; }PER; 则以下定义结构体数组并赋初值的语句中错误的是()。
有3个关系R、S和T如下所示: 则由关系R和关系s得到关系T的运算是()。
在长度为n的顺序表中查找一个元素,假设需要查找的元素一定在表中,并且元素出现在表中每个位置上的可能性是相同的,则平均需要比较的次数为()。
算术运算符和圆括号有不同的运算优先级,对于表达式:a+b+c*(d+e),关于执行顺序,以下说法正确的是()。
若变量x、y已正确定义并赋值,以下符合C语言语法的表达式是()。
随机试题
Access中包括哪几种查询方式?各自的特点是什么?
“改革是中国的第二次革命。”()
用于颗粒干燥颗粒外形圆整、大小均匀、流动性好
A、膜控释小丸B、渗透泵片C、微球D、纳米球E、溶蚀性骨架片以控制扩散速率为原理的缓、控释制剂()
流行性脑脊髓炎典型皮肤特征
某两车道隧道开挖后采用喷射混凝土支护,某检测单位对该隧道初期支护的质量进行检测。请回答下列问题。隧道锚杆拉拔力测试,以下叙述错误的有()。
王某为某建筑公司提供大厦图纸设计,工作结束后,建筑公司在代扣代缴了个人所得税后,向王某支付了报酬68000元。建筑公司应代扣代缴王某的个人所得税()元。
芭蕾舞剧《天鹅湖》的作者是()。
下列各省市地区举办过中华人民共和国全国运动会的有()。
下面有几个关于局域网的说法,其中不正确的是______。
最新回复
(
0
)